WIRRAL residents will be heading to the polls today as Pensby and Thingwall’s by-election gets underway.
The election was called after Tory councillor Don McCubbin stood down earlier this year due to personal reasons.
It is the borough’s third by-election this year following polls in Leasowe and Moreton East and Heswall in January.
The candidates hoping to secure enough votes for a place in the town hall are: Phillip Brightmore for Labour and the Co-operative Party; Allen Burton for The Green Party; Sheila Clarke for Conservatives; Damien Cummins for Liberal Democrats; Jan Davison for UKIP; and Neil Kenny for the English Democrats.
